Attention all Mulder and Scully shippers: The X-Files‘ David Duchovny and Gillian Anderson sang together Tuesday night.
The two are reuniting for more X-Files, but that won’t come until January, as Entertainment Weekly reported. No, this was some extracurricular crooning at New York’s The Cutting Room, where Duchovny was holding a concert on the day his album, Hell or Highwater, was released.
According to Sky News, before launching into Neil Young’s “Helpless” the two engaged in some light ribbing. “Can we play some real music please?” Anderson reportedly said.
The quality of the singing is debatable, but there’s a squeal-worthy moment at the end.
